Can magnets be taken on planes? A practical overview
If you’re asking can you take refrigerator magnets on a plane, the answer is generally yes, but there are caveats. Magnets are not categorized as dangerous items, and most small fridge magnets travel in carry-on or checked baggage without issue. However, security screening around magnetic items can vary by airport and country. Very strong or unusual magnets may attract attention or require additional handling. Always verify rules with your airline and the security authority for your itinerary. According to How To Refrigerator, magnets are a common travel item, but clear guidelines help avoid delays.
